Flat Tire vs. Blowout During a Breakdown: Key Differences and Safety Tips

A flat tire occurs gradually as air slowly escapes, allowing the driver to maintain partial control, while a blowout is a sudden and violent loss of tire pressure causing immediate loss of control. Blowouts pose a higher risk of accidents due to the abrupt impact on vehicle stability, often requiring quick, precise handling. Understanding the differences between flat tires and blowouts is crucial for safe vehicle operation and proper emergency response.

Causes of Flat Tires vs Blowouts

Flat tires typically result from slow leaks caused by punctures from nails, sharp objects, or valve stem failures, while blowouts usually stem from sudden tire damage like hitting potholes, overinflation, or tire tread separation. A flat tire develops gradually as air escapes, whereas a blowout occurs abruptly, often due to weakened tire structure or sidewall damage. Regular tire maintenance and inspection help prevent both issues by identifying signs of wear, embedded debris, or pressure inconsistencies.

Signs of a Flat Tire vs a Blowout

A flat tire typically presents as a slow loss of air pressure, causing the vehicle to feel unstable or pull to one side, often accompanied by a visible deflation or bulging on the tire surface. In contrast, a blowout is characterized by a sudden, loud popping noise followed by an immediate and severe loss of control due to rapid air escape, causing the vehicle to swerve abruptly. Recognizing these signs quickly can prevent accidents and ensure timely roadside assistance.

Immediate Actions: Flat Tire vs Blowout

A flat tire requires gradually pulling over to a safe area, activating hazard lights, and replacing the tire with a spare or calling roadside assistance. In the case of a blowout, maintain firm control of the steering wheel, avoid sudden braking, and slowly decelerate while steering the vehicle safely off the road. Both situations demand prompt assessment of the surrounding traffic conditions and ensuring passenger safety before proceeding.

Safety Risks: Flat Tire Compared to Blowout

A flat tire reduces vehicle control gradually, allowing drivers more time to react, whereas a blowout causes a sudden loss of tire pressure that can lead to immediate steering difficulties and potential accidents. Blowouts significantly increase the risk of rollovers or collisions due to abrupt handling failures at high speeds. Proper tire maintenance and regular pressure checks are critical to minimizing these safety risks on the road.

Tire Maintenance to Prevent Flats and Blowouts

Proper tire maintenance is crucial to prevent flats and blowouts, including regular inspections for tread wear, sidewall damage, and embedded objects. Maintaining correct tire pressure enhances tire performance and reduces the risk of blowouts caused by over- or under-inflation. Rotating tires every 5,000 to 7,500 miles and ensuring timely alignment also extend tire life and prevent uneven wear that can lead to sudden tire failure.

Repair Process: Flat Tire vs Blowout

Repairing a flat tire typically involves removing the tire from the vehicle, patching or plugging the puncture, and re-inflating it, which can often be done roadside or at a tire shop. Blowout repairs are more complex due to the extensive damage to the tire's sidewall and structure, usually necessitating full tire replacement to ensure safety. Time and cost for fixing a flat tire are generally lower, whereas blowouts demand immediate attention and higher expenses due to the severity of the damage.

Cost Comparison: Flat Tire vs Blowout

Repairing a flat tire typically costs between $20 and $50 for patching or replacement, while a blowout can result in expenses exceeding $200 due to potential damage to the rim, suspension, or alignment. Flat tire repairs usually involve minor labor and parts, whereas blowouts often require extensive mechanical work and new components. Choosing preventive maintenance on tires reduces the risk of costly blowouts compared to more affordable flat tire fixes.
